Unfortunately my hands are a bit tied as I don’t want to break forum rules regarding DIY fixes!
The acrylic fascia is held to the aluminium front panel with self adhesive.
The screws that secure the front panel to the support brackets are only M2 threads & as such cannot be screwed up very tight (as the head will shear off), they do have a habit of working loose.
